We had the same problem on our Pfaff. We think that we get lint balls or thread in the tension discs. Try loosening the tension as much as you can, then take dental floss to the discs and see if you dislodge anything. I have taken mine completely apart before, but if you do that be prepared to pay VERY CAREFUL attention to all the parts and how they fit together.
